I LOVE this deck, and actually it was my first.
The thing to remember is that it is not a "traditional" tarot deck. Some of the meanings are a little... deeper, or require more insight, I guess, than an average deck. It was worth it to me though, most definitely!
But its great, and if you want it, I'd say go for it. :)

I have these cards and also the book Tarot in the Spirit of Zen by Osho. The book includes twenty-two major arcana pop-out cards from the Osho Zen Tarot. These cards are small but for anyone who likes to read with just majors or to use these cards for one card extra insight, these are perfect!
Paid $21.95 for the book Canadian.
